Output 940343c133ce0b06715d99e791b3d5200bfd7d07dbdd218633a524ea9c082f56:6

value
17310327
script pubkey
OP_0 OP_PUSHBYTES_32 c4cb9deb3b07d9e44ccd18cc43ff315764573905be3cb37a8da9b62369845595
address
bc1qcn9em6emqlv7gnxdrrxy8le32aj9wwg9hc7tx75d4xmzx6vy2k2sg82ujx
transaction
940343c133ce0b06715d99e791b3d5200bfd7d07dbdd218633a524ea9c082f56
spent
true